WebSep 13, 2024 · When rural hospitals close, they “have an outsized impact” on the rural population’s health and economic well-being. Yet, these hospitals and health systems continue to shutter at an unprecedented rate, AHA explains. Low patient volumes are a top reason driving rural hospital closures.
